Endoparasitic fauna of red foxes (Vulpes vulpes) and golden jackals (Canis aureus) in Serbia.

作者信息

Ilić Tamara, Becskei Zsolt, Petrović Tamaš, Polaček Vladimir, Ristić Bojan, Milić Siniša, Stepanović Predrag, Radisavljević Katarina, Dimitrijević Sanda

出版信息

Acta Parasitol. 2016 Mar;61(2):389-96. doi: 10.1515/ap-2016-0051.

DOI:10.1515/ap-2016-0051
PMID:27078664
Abstract

Wild canides have a high epizootiological - epidemiological significance, considering that they are hosts for some parasites which spread vector born diseases. Increased frequency of certain interactions between domestic and wild canides increases the risk of occurrence, spreading and maintaining the infection of parasitic etiology in domestic canides. The research was conducted in 232 wild canides (172 red foxes and 60 golden jackals). The examined material was sampled from foxes and jackals, which were hunted down between 2010 and 2014, from 8 epizootiological areas of Serbia (North-Bačka, West-Bačka, Southern-Banat, Moravički, Zlatiborski, Raški, Rasinski and Zaječarski district). On completing the parasitological dissection and the coprological diagnostics, in wild canides protozoa from the genus Isospora were identified, 3 species of trematoda (Alaria alata, Pseudamphistomum truncatum and Metagonimus yokogawai), cestods from the genus Taenia and 5 species of nematodes (Toxocara canis, Ancylostomatidae, Trichuris vulpis and Capillaria aerophila). The finding of M. yokogawai in golden jackals were, to the best of our knowledge, one of the first diagnosed cases of metagonimosis in golden jackals in Serbia. The continued monitoring of the parasitic fauna of wild canides is needed to establish the widespread of the zoonoses in different regions of Serbia, because they present the reservoirs and/or sources of these infections.

摘要

野生犬科动物具有很高的动物流行病学意义,因为它们是一些传播媒介传播疾病的寄生虫的宿主。家犬与野生犬科动物之间特定互动频率的增加,增加了家犬发生、传播和维持寄生虫病因感染的风险。该研究对232只野生犬科动物(172只赤狐和60只金豺)进行了调查。检测材料取自2010年至2014年间在塞尔维亚8个动物疫源地(北巴奇卡、西巴奇卡、南巴纳特、莫拉维奇、兹拉蒂博尔斯基、拉什基、拉辛斯基和扎耶恰尔斯基地区)捕杀的狐狸和豺。在完成寄生虫解剖和粪便学诊断后,在野生犬科动物中鉴定出了等孢属原生动物、3种吸虫(翼形吸虫、截形伪双腔吸虫和横川后殖吸虫)、带绦虫属绦虫和5种线虫(犬弓首蛔虫、钩口科线虫、狐毛首线虫和嗜气毛细线虫)。据我们所知,在金豺中发现横川后殖吸虫是塞尔维亚金豺中首例被诊断出的后殖吸虫病病例。需要持续监测野生犬科动物的寄生虫区系,以确定塞尔维亚不同地区人畜共患病的传播情况,因为它们是这些感染的储存宿主和/或来源。
